Finance Business Partner
The government seeks a finance business partner to join the financial advisory services team.
This role involves partnering with schools to strengthen their financial management practices and support effective resource allocation that contributes to improved educational outcomes for students.
* Support the development and delivery of financial management training material to support schools.
* Assist with the development and communication of school accounting policies and procedures.
The position is based in North Lakes or Nundah, providing advice and support to school staff regarding financial management.
Key Responsibilities:
* Undertake analysis of the financial management practices and financial performance of schools.
* Provide financial management advice to school-based staff.
* Monitor the level of financial management competencies within schools.
* Provide appropriate training and development programs to enhance financial management skills.
* Work effectively in a team environment.
Requirements:
* Sound knowledge of contemporary financial management issues and strategies impacting schools.
* Ability to interrogate and analyse school financial management systems - Agresso and OneSchool Finance.
* Ability to deliver training programs relating to school financial management, including in an online format.
* High-level communication skills, both written and oral, with ability to influence customer behaviour and implement change.
* Demonstrated leadership and management skills appropriate to achieving outcomes within negotiated timeframes.
As a finance business partner, you will play a key role in supporting the financial management needs of schools. You will work closely with school staff to develop and deliver financial management training and provide advice on accounting policies and procedures.
